RES Motor Vehicle Lecturer (2x Roles)

Location:

Dearne Valley College, Rotherham

Salary:
Up to £25.14 per hour plus holiday pay (dependant on experience and teaching qualification)

Vacancy Type:
Temporary until June 2026

Hours:

Full or Part Time

The Role

You will deliver Motor Vehicle Levels 1-3 students at Dearne Valley College. You will have the opportunity not only to impart your knowledge and expertise to adult learners, but ultimately will make an impact on the wider community.

You will play a key role in delivering outstanding quality teaching, learning and assessment which will support students to achieve their best no matter what their challenges are to do so, and present yourself as a positive role model to students.

Responsibilities
  • Hold a teaching qualification or be working towards
  • Hold a level 3+ professional qualification in Motor Vehicle
  • Have experience of teaching students/apprentices
  • Be well organised and able to manage your own workload
  • Hold an assessor's award (Desirable)
